We are looking for a motivated Multiskilled Maintenance Engineer to join a market leading company in their respective field. Reporting directly to the maintenance manager you will be a key member in ensuring the production facility is kept running. You will be involved in all aspects of planned and reactive maintenance within their operation. With progressive training and development, this company is always looking to enhance its employees and their skill sets, whilst additionally being supported by a welcoming team of engineers. The position will appeal to a strong engineer looking for their next challenging role within a secure and stable company.

Role Description

  • Providing both Reactive & PPM maintenance
  • Working on a variety of machinery
  • Being involved in facilities work
  • Fault Finding both Electrical & Mechanical
  • Working in a manufacturing environment
  • Hydraulics and Pneumatics

Skills and Qualifications

  • Fast Paced Manufacturing Experience Advantageous
  • Fault Finding ability either Electrical or Mechanical
  • Engineering Qualifications Necessary
